What is an ai assistant for enterprise teams?

An ai assistant for enterprise teams is an advanced software application that leverages artificial intelligence technology to support various tasks within a corporate environment. It is designed to automate mundane tasks, assist in project management, manage scheduling, and provide intelligent insights. Generally accessed through various interfaces such as web applications, mobile apps, or integrated with communication platforms, these assistants utilize nat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ning capabilities to adapt to user preferences and behaviors over time.

Implementation strategies for ai assistant for enterprise teams

The implementation of an ai assistant can be a significant organizational change. Follow these strategic steps for a smooth transition.

Step-by-step implementation guide

Implementing an ai assistant requires careful planning and execution. Here are essential steps to ensure a successful rollout:

  1. Assessment: Review existing workflows to identify inefficiencies and areas for automation.
  2. Selection: Choose an ai assistant that meets your criteria and aligns with company goals.
  3. Configuration: Set up the assistant according to your team’s needs and integrate with existing toolsets.
  4. Pilot Testing: Conduct a pilot program with a limited user base to gather feedback and make necessary adjustments.
  5. Full Rollout: Launch the ai assistant across the organization with training sessions for all users.
